How long does the face-slimming injection last?
“Face-slimming injections” refer to botulinum toxin type A (Botox) injections, which primarily target muscle tissue. They are commonly used to treat masseter muscle hypertrophy and are thus colloquially termed “face-slimming injections.” So, how long do the effects of face-slimming injections last?

How Long Do Face-Slimming Injection Effects Last?
The effects of face-slimming injections typically last approximately 6 to 12 months. These injections contain botulinum toxin; however, its effect gradually diminishes over time, after which the masseter muscles may temporarily re-enlarge, necessitating repeat injections. Repeated treatments help stabilize and prolong the results. The active ingredient is botulinum toxin produced by *Clostridium botulinum*. Upon injection, it blocks neuromuscular signal transmission, thereby reducing masseter muscle bulk and improving associated symptoms of hypertrophy. It may also be used to address localized fat accumulation. Noticeable effects usually appear within 3–5 days post-injection, while visible facial contouring typically becomes apparent after about two to four weeks. With consistent, regular treatments, results tend to be more sustained. Face-slimming injections are a popular minimally invasive cosmetic procedure; most patients observe significant improvement within approximately one month. For optimal maintenance, injections are generally recommended every three months.

After receiving face-slimming injections, avoid hot baths and saunas for at least 24 hours, and refrain from visiting heavily polluted environments. For one week following treatment, avoid consuming hard, chewy, or spicy foods.
